Chef Ariane Duarte of CulinAriane has put up a new recipe on her DinnerTool blog, and it’s a tribute to all things Spring.

Duarte says she concocted the dish, Farro Ragu with Sweet Potato and Chickpea Salad with Artichokes, Morels and Spring Onions, for a friend who is a vegetarian. The recipe is not all that complicated, but if you have trouble finding farro, head to a food store owned by two other Verona residents: Mia Famiglia in Millburn. Sharon and Manny Licitra stock the whole grain and other Italian specialty items.
